TL;DR
Medical Operations Specialist (Healthtech): Supporting clinician onboarding, product adoption, and AI assistant refinement for a clinical co-pilot platform with an accent on DACH region healthcare workflows. Focus on bridging the gap between clinical users and internal product/engineering teams to ensure safe and effective implementation.

Location: Must be based in Munich, Germany (On-site role with required travel to Stockholm)

hirify.global is a fast-scaling health-tech company building an AI-powered clinician co-pilot to improve patient care.

What you will do

  • Guide clinicians through onboarding, training, and day-to-day support.
  • Build templates and prompts to refine the AI assistant's performance.
  • Run live product demos for prospective clients and support commercial efforts.
  • Manage clinical safety incidents and optimize internal operations.
  • Collaborate with product, engineering, and commercial teams to ensure smooth rollouts.
  • Represent the company at conferences and industry events.

Requirements

  • Clinical experience in a healthcare setting (e.g., general practice or hospital).
  • Native German and fluent English proficiency.
  • Experience in consulting, corporate, or startup environments.
  • Familiarity with prompting and large language models (LLMs).
  • Must be based in Munich and willing to travel locally and to Stockholm.
  • Strong organizational skills and a process-driven mindset.

Nice to have

  • Experience in a healthtech or SaaS company.
  • Exposure to regulatory standards in DACH or EU (e.g., clinical safety, digital health compliance).
  • Experience running implementation projects or customer-facing rollouts.

Culture & Benefits

  • High-performing, diverse team focused on healthcare innovation.
  • Collaborative environment with regular team meetings and offsites in Sweden.
  • Opportunity to shape product development and AI integration.
  • Culture built on action, ambition, and continuous learning.

Hiring process

  • Screening interview with Talent Acquisition.
  • First interview with the DACH Country Manager.
  • Follow-up interview with Medical Operations team members.
  • Working Day in the Stockholm office to experience the culture and team collaboration.
